Voile T Wood Shovel

As its name suggests, the Voile T Wood Shovel was designed with a T grip and comes with a saw that can even cut wood. The T handle is more compact for storage in your pack than a D grip, and the shovel's construction is a tad lighter than other models. Inside its shaft, the T Shovel stores a hi-tensile steel saw blade that will cut through just about anything including wood and steel. The saw blade easily attaches to the telescoping shovel shaft for extended reach. This telescoping shovel and wood saw make the perfect combo for backcountry travel and safety.

Bottom Line: A pefect tool for when things go wrong, and when you might need to cut something besides snow.

Another great shovel from Voile. This one comes in all flavors of scoops; T6, mini or standard size aluminum. The saw is a fine tooth blade, unlike the T6 avalache shovel which is a coarse rip saw. If you want the options of telescoping handle and different scoop types, get this one. Otherwise the T6 avalanche shovel saw blade is more universal and quicker to saw through wood.

I use this shovel for building snowboard jumps in the backcountry, and hopefully that is all I will ever have to use it for. I have heard some people mention t-handles being hard to use in comparison to d-handles, I have not had a problem with the t-handle on this shovel especially with gloves on. Plus the t-handle travels much better than a d. Have not had to use the saw yet but it is nice to know it is there, and it is the only one I have found that can cut wood. Highly recommended and its bomber construction feels super solid.

I bought this shovel online so I didn’t have the benefit of looking at it first. Frankly, since it was a Voile, I thought it would do fine.
- The T handle is not as nice as the D Handle.
- The little spring clips Voile uses to hold the handle, blade and saw in place can get sprung right out. Fortunately for me I found mine in the snow on the trail of Mt Pierce at the start of the Presi-Traverse and didn’t have to use duct tape and bailing wire to hold it together.

Think Twice about this isn't ideally designed with winter backcountry use in mind.

Tech Specs:

Shaft Material:
Aluminum 
Blade Material:
Aluminum 
Length Attached:
28" 
Length Detached:
17" 
Blade Size:
16" 
Telescoping:
Yes 36" 
Saw Included:
Yes (hi-tensile steel saw) 
Probe Included:
No 
Recommended use:
Avalanche Safety; Backcountry snowmobiling 
Weight:
2lbs 
Warranty:
Lifetime 
Country of Origin:
United States
